Which statement best illustrates why carbon is important to living things?

Biology
1 answer:
Sunny_sXe [5.5K]4 years ago
4 0
Carbon-based macro molecules are found in all life forms.

How do amphibians breathe on land and in water​
gizmo_the_mogwai [7]

Answer:

Most amphibians can breathe both through cutaneous respiration (through their skin) and buccal pumping - though some also retain gills as adults. Some aquatic salamanders (and all tadpoles) have gills and can breathe underwater thanks to them. The Mexican axolotl, for example, never loses its gills.
